    • Disclosed is a method for making α,ω-allyl terminated macromonomers comprising a plurality of units of an α,β-unsaturated carboxylic acid. The method comprises forming a first mixture containing an ester of an α,β-unsaturated carboxylic acid, a radical initiator comprising an allyl group and a halogen, and a catalyst comprising a transition metal complex. The ester of the α,β-unsaturated carboxylic acid is an ester capable of reacting with a mixture comprising trifluoroacetic acid (TFA) to form the α,β-unsaturated carboxylic acid. The mixture is stirred to form a second mixture containing an α-allyl,ω-halogen-terminated macromonomer comprising a plurality of units of the ester of the α,β-unsaturated carboxylic acid. A third mixture comprising a compound containing at least one transferable allyl group is then added to the second mixture to form a fourth mixture containing a first α,ω-allyl terminated macromonomer comprising a plurality of units of the ester of the α,β-unsaturated carboxylic acid. The first α,ω-allyl terminated macromonomer is separated from the fourth mixture and is mixed with a mixture containing TFA to form a fifth mixture containing the α,ω-allyl terminated macromonomer comprising a plurality of units of the α,β-unsaturated carboxylic acid. The α,ω-allyl terminated macromonomer comprising a plurality of units of the α,β-unsaturated carboxylic acid is then separated from the fifth mixture. Also enclosed is a related method for making end-linked hydrogels comprising a plurality of units of an α,β-unsaturated carboxylic acid. The method comprises forming a first mixture containing an α,ω-allyl terminated macromonomer comprising a plurality of units of the α,β-unsaturated carboxylic acid and a radical initiator. The first mixture is treated with UV-radiation, visible light, or heat to form a second mixture comprising an end-linked hydrogel comprising a plurality of units of the α,β-unsaturated carboxylic acid.
    • 公开了一种制备包含多个α,β-不饱和羧酸单元的α,ω-烯丙基封端的大分子单体的方法。 该方法包括形成含有α,β-不饱和羧酸的酯,包含烯丙基和卤素的自由基引发剂和包含过渡金属络合物的催化剂的第一混合物。 α,β-不饱和羧酸的酯是能够与包含三氟乙酸(TFA)的混合物反应以形成α,β-不饱和羧酸的酯。 将混合物搅拌以形成包含α-烯丙基,ω-卤素封端的大分子单体的第二混合物,其包含多个α,β-不饱和羧酸的酯单元。 然后将包含至少一个可转移的烯丙基的化合物的第三混合物加入到第二混合物中以形成包含第一个α,ω-烯丙基封端的大分子单体的第四混合物,其包含多个单位的α,β-不饱和的 羧酸。 将第一个α,ω-烯丙基封端的大分子单体与第四混合物分离,并与含有TFA的混合物混合以形成包含α,ω-烯丙基封端的大分子单体的第五混合物,其包含多个单位的α,β-不饱和羧酸 酸。 然后将包含多个α,β-不饱和羧酸单元的α,ω-烯丙基封端的大分子单体与第五混合物分离。 还包括用于制备包含多个α,β-不饱和羧酸单元的端联水凝胶的相关方法。 该方法包括形成包含α,ω-烯丙基封端的大分子单体的第一混合物,其包含多个α,β-不饱和羧酸单元和自由基引发剂。 用UV辐射,可见光或加热处理第一混合物以形成第二混合物,其包含包含多个α,β-不饱和羧酸单元的端基水凝胶。
